EDV / IT » Softwareentwicklung
Jobbeschreibung / Berufsprofil

Die faszinierende Welt des Softwareentwicklers für Embedded Software

Die Entwicklung von Embedded Software ist ein faszinierendes und dynamisches Feld, das im Zentrum der modernen Technologie steht. Softwareentwickler, die sich auf Embedded Software spezialisieren, spielen eine entscheidende Rolle in der Gestaltung und Implementierung von Systemen, die in einer Vielzahl von Geräten und Anwendungen integriert sind, von Automobilen bis hin zu medizinischen Geräten. Diese Experten kombinieren tiefgreifendes technisches Wissen mit kreativer Problemlösung, um innovative Lösungen zu entwickeln, die die Funktionalität und Effizienz von Embedded Systems verbessern.

Tätigkeitsfeld und Aufgaben

Softwareentwickler für Embedded Software arbeiten an der Schnittstelle von Hardware und Software. Ihre Hauptaufgabe ist die Entwicklung von Systemsoftware, die direkt auf der Hardware läuft, oft ohne Betriebssystem oder mit einem spezialisierten Echtzeitbetriebssystem. Diese Software steuert die Funktionen spezifischer Geräte und muss daher effizient, zuverlässig und in der Lage sein, in Echtzeit zu reagieren. Zu den typischen Aufgaben gehören das Design, die Implementierung und die Wartung von Software für Embedded Systems, die Programmierung in Sprachen wie C und C++, die Integration von Software mit Hardwarekomponenten, das Debugging und die Optimierung von Systemleistung sowie die Dokumentation des Entwicklungsprozesses.

Ausbildungsvoraussetzungen

Die Grundlage für eine Karriere als Softwareentwickler für Embedded Software bildet in der Regel ein Studium in Informatik, Elektrotechnik oder einem verwandten technischen Bereich. Während des Studiums erwerben die Studierenden fundierte Kenntnisse in Programmierung, insbesondere in Sprachen wie C und C++, die für die Entwicklung von Embedded Software von zentraler Bedeutung sind. Darüber hinaus sind Kurse in Elektrotechnik wichtig, um ein Verständnis für die Hardwarekomponenten zu entwickeln, mit denen die Software interagieren wird.

Erforderliche persönliche Eigenschaften

Neben den technischen Fähigkeiten erfordert die Arbeit als Softwareentwickler für Embedded Software auch bestimmte persönliche Eigenschaften. Dazu gehören analytisches Denken und Problemlösungsfähigkeiten, um komplexe Herausforderungen zu bewältigen. Detailorientierung ist entscheidend, da selbst kleine Fehler in der Software schwerwiegende Auswirkungen haben können. Kreativität und Innovationsgeist helfen bei der Entwicklung neuer Lösungen. Teamfähigkeit ist ebenfalls wichtig, da Entwickler oft in multidisziplinären Teams arbeiten.

Ausbildungsweg

Der typische Ausbildungsweg zum Softwareentwickler für Embedded Software beginnt mit einem Bachelorstudium in Informatik, Elektrotechnik oder einem verwandten Bereich. Viele Universitäten bieten spezialisierte Kurse oder Studiengänge in Embedded Systems an, die eine solide Grundlage für diese Karriere bieten. Praktika und Werkstudententätigkeiten in relevanten Industrien, wie der Automotive-Branche, können wertvolle praktische Erfahrungen bieten. Einige Positionen erfordern möglicherweise einen Masterabschluss oder spezifische Zertifizierungen in Technologien oder Programmiersprachen.

Arbeitsbereiche

Softwareentwickler für Embedded Software finden Beschäftigung in einer Vielzahl von Industrien, darunter Automotive, Luft- und Raumfahrt, Telekommunikation, Medizintechnik und Konsumelektronik. In der Automotive-Branche entwickeln sie beispielsweise Software für Fahrassistenzsysteme, Infotainment-Systeme und elektronische Steuergeräte. In der Medizintechnik arbeiten sie an der Software für Geräte wie Herzschrittmacher oder Insulinpumpen.

Berufsaussichten

Die Berufsaussichten für Softwareentwickler für Embedded Software sind ausgezeichnet. Die zunehmende Digitalisierung und Vernetzung in allen Lebensbereichen führt zu einer steigenden Nachfrage nach intelligenten Geräten und Systemen, die Embedded Software benötigen. Insbesondere die Bereiche Automotive, Industrie 4.0 und das Internet der Dinge (IoT) bieten starke Wachstumspotenziale.

Jahreseinkommen

Das Jahreseinkommen von Softwareentwicklern für Embedded Software variiert je nach Erfahrung, Qualifikation und Branche. In Deutschland bewegt sich das durchschnittliche Jahresgehalt in der Regel zwischen 50.000 und 70.000 Euro. Erfahrene Entwickler in führenden Positionen oder in besonders gefragten Branchen können auch höhere Gehälter erzielen.

Fazit

Die Rolle des Softwareentwicklers für Embedded Software ist entscheidend für die Entwicklung und Innovation in einer Vielzahl von technologischen Bereichen. Mit einer soliden Ausbildung in Informatik oder Elektrotechnik, starken Programmierkenntnissen, insbesondere in C und C++, sowie den erforderlichen persönlichen Eigenschaften, können angehende Entwickler eine erfolgreiche Karriere in diesem spannenden und zukunftsorientierten Feld aufbauen. Die ausgezeichneten Berufsaussichten und das attraktive Jahreseinkommen machen diesen Beruf zu einer lohnenden Wahl für technikbegeisterte Individuen.


Jahreseinkommen (von/bis)
Softwareentwickler Embedded Software:

EUR 50.000,-bisEUR 70.000,-


Anzahl Jobs zu Softwareentwickler Embedded Software:


Weitere verwandte Berufsprofile: